Cancer is the second leading cause of human death globally, estimated to be responsible for one in six deaths. All the factors that affect cancer occurrence are not well known but include ionizing radiation, aging, and exposure to some chemicals, among others. There is evidence of cancer induction by microbial metabolites; however, more investigation is necessary to establish the carcinogenicity of each suspected microbial metabolite.
